In a “highly competitive situation,” Netflix acquires action spec script “The Operator” written by Harrison Query. Via Deadline:

Reps for Netflix declined to comment. We’re told that the film has Wahlberg playing an ex-Tier One Operator who earns a living as one of the CIA’s invisible clean-up men. When he’s ordered to shepherd his most hated target to safety, the mission turns into a high-stakes cat and mouse game for survival.

Mark Wahlberg is attached to star.

Since September, 5 of the announced 8 spec script deals announced in the time have been Netflix acquisitions.

It’s been a banner year for Query, who earlier this year got competitive bidding going over “Code Black,” a short story he sold to Amazon MGM, where he will be adapting, with Jake Gyllenhaal starring and producing alongside Sixth & Idaho and Glassgold’s 12:01 Films. Earlier this year, he saw Heads of State, his Amazon MGM actioner starring John Cena and Idris Elba, establish itself as Prime Video’s fourth-most-streamed movie of all time. Up next for him is Paramount+/101 Studios’ JonBenét Ramsey limited series, starring Melissa McCarthy and Clive Owen, where he’s co-creator and EP.

By my count, this is the 28th spec script deal in 2025.

There were 24 spec script deals year-to-date in 2024.
